Dharampura - Dolvan, Tapi
Dharampura is a village situated in the Dolvan taluka of Tapi district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 31 km from Vyara and around 31 km from Vyara. Kalakva ser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dharampura village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dharampura is 524805. The village covers a total geographical area of 239.35 hectares and falls under the 394630 pincode. Vyara is the nearest town, located about 31 km away.
Dharampura village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Vyara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bardoli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Dharampura
According to the 2011 Census, Dharampura village had a total population of 442 people, including 225 males and 217 females, living in 104 households. The sex ratio was 964 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 72.06%, with male literacy at 80.41% and female literacy at 63.49%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 54,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 363.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 442 | 225 | 217 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 59 | 31 | 28 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 54 | 28 | 26 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 363 | 184 | 179 |
| Literate Population | 276 | 156 | 120 |
| Illiterate Population | 166 | 69 | 97 |

Transport and Connectivity of Dharampura
Dharampura is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Vyara to Dharampura is about 31 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Dharampura
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Dharampura village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Dharampura
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Dharampura village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
